GFCI (Ground Fault Circuit Interrupter) outlet wiring services involve installing, replacing, or repairing outlets equipped with GFCI technology. These outlets are designed to quickly cut off power when a ground fault or leakage is detected, helping to prevent electrical shocks and reduce the risk of electrical fires. Professionals assess existing wiring systems and ensure that GFCI outlets are properly integrated into residential, commercial, or industrial properties. Proper installation includes verifying that the outlets are correctly wired and functioning as intended, providing enhanced safety in areas prone to moisture or water exposure.

This service addresses common electrical problems such as frequent tripping of outlets, outdated wiring systems lacking GFCI protection, or the need to upgrade safety features in existing electrical setups. It is particularly useful in locations where water or moisture is present, like kitchens, bathrooms, laundry rooms, and outdoor spaces. By installing GFCI outlets, property owners can mitigate the risk of electrical shocks caused by faulty wiring or accidental contact with water. Additionally, replacing old outlets with GFCI models can improve overall electrical safety standards and compliance with local building codes.

Cost Range for GFCI Outlet Wiring - The typical cost for wiring a GFCI outlet can vary from $100 to $200 per outlet, depending on the complexity of the installation and local rates. For example, a standard installation in North Easton, MA, might fall within this range.

Additional Expenses to Consider - Costs may increase if wiring requires additional work such as replacing existing circuits or upgrading panels, which can add $50 to $150 to the overall price. Some projects may also incur fees for permits or inspections.

Factors Influencing Pricing - The cost of GFCI outlet wiring services often depends on the number of outlets, accessibility, and whether electrical boxes need to be replaced or added. Labor rates in North Easton, MA, typically range from $75 to $125 per hour.

Average Project Cost - For a typical home installation of a few GFCI outlets, the total cost might range from $200 to $600, including materials and labor, but prices can vary based on specific project details and local contractor rates.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a GFCI outlet? A GFCI outlet is a safety device designed to protect people from electrical shock by monitoring the flow of electricity and shutting off power if a ground fault is detected.

Why might I need GFCI outlet wiring services? GFCI outlets are required in areas with high moisture, such as kitchens and bathrooms, and professional wiring ensures they are installed correctly for safety and code compliance.

How long does GFCI outlet wiring typically take? The installation process usually takes a few hours, depending on the number of outlets and the complexity of the existing wiring.

Are GFCI outlets compatible with existing wiring? Yes, in most cases, GFCI outlets can be installed with existing wiring, but a professional assessment is recommended to ensure proper setup.
